Subject: [PATCH 1/2] btrfs: enable discard support
Date: Wed, 14 Oct 2009 03:03:02 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20091014010302.GA21031@lst.de> (raw)
The discard support code in btrfs currently is guarded by ifdefs for
BIO_RW_DISCARD, which is never defines as it's the name of an enum
memeber. Just remove the useless ifdefs to actually enable the code.
Signed-off-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
Index: linux-2.6/fs/btrfs/extent-tree.c
===================================================================
--- linux-2.6.orig/fs/btrfs/extent-tree.c 2009-10-07 11:04:18.451256181 -0400
+++ linux-2.6/fs/btrfs/extent-tree.c 2009-10-07 11:04:26.225005458 -0400
@@ -1568,19 +1568,16 @@ static int remove_extent_backref(struct
return ret;
}
-#ifdef BIO_RW_DISCARD
static void btrfs_issue_discard(struct block_device *bdev,
u64 start, u64 len)
{
blkdev_issue_discard(bdev, start >> 9, len >> 9, GFP_KERNEL,
DISCARD_FL_BARRIER);
}
-#endif
static int btrfs_discard_extent(struct btrfs_root *root, u64 bytenr,
u64 num_bytes)
{
-#ifdef BIO_RW_DISCARD
int ret;
u64 map_length = num_bytes;
struct btrfs_multi_bio *multi = NULL;
@@ -1604,9 +1601,6 @@ static int btrfs_discard_extent(struct b
}
return ret;
-#else
- return 0;
-#endif
}
